Job Description

The Digital Solution Architect works with the product owner team by providing business process alignment and technical support to craft a solution that is fit for purpose from a business perspective.
Work with other domain architects in the programme including cloud infrastructure, technology and domain specific architects. Monitors adherence to architectural standards for the development, deployment and management of application, information, communication and technology infrastructure

Old Mutual Limited is a listed company on the Johannesburg Stock Exchange and has secondary listings on the London, Malawi, Namibia and Zimbabwe stock exchanges. As a Pan-African financial services company, we are focused on Africa, her needs and her people.
